Simon développeur PEEL

Administrateur PEEL
  • Compteur de contenus

    2 913
  • Inscrit(e) le

  • Dernière visite


Tout ce qui a été posté par Simon développeur PEEL

  1. Simon développeur PEEL a ajouté un message dans un sujet  Ajout d'un produit : le troisème bug systématiquement ...   

    Bonjour,

    Le problème vient de la page blanche. Le fait de rafraichir la page active une sécurité de PEEL qui empêche de soumettre plusieurs fois le même formulaire. C'est cette sécurité qui affiche le message
    "token invalide : traitement déjà validé ou référer http non renseigné"
    => Il faut comprendre pourquoi une page blanche s'affiche lors de la soumission du formulaire. Avez-vous regardé dans les logs d'erreurs ?
    • 0
  2. Simon développeur PEEL a ajouté un message dans un sujet  Erreurs constatées sur facture Proforma   

    Bonjour,


    => Oui, dans la commande HTML (modules/factures/commande_html.php), le bloc de code suivant affiche le type de paiement choisi pour la commande, ou l'ensemble des moyens de paiement si aucun n'est défini :


    if (!empty($commande->paiement)) {
    // Affichage du mode de paiement défini pour cette commande
    $output .= '
    <tr>
    <td colspan="2">' . get_payment_form($commande->id, $commande->paiement, false, $amount_to_pay, false) . '</td>
    </tr>';
    } else {
    $sql_paiement = 'SELECT p.technical_code
    FROM peel_paiement p
    WHERE p.etat = "1"
    ORDER BY p.position';
    $res_paiement = query($sql_paiement);
    while ($tab_paiement = fetch_assoc($res_paiement)) {
    if (!empty($tab_paiement['technical_code'])) {
    // Attention, l'url du formulaire de paiement par CB doit &#234;tre sp&#233;cifi&#233; dans le back office de certain systeme de paiement, notamment ogone.
    $output .= '
    <tr>
    <td colspan="2"><hr />' . get_payment_form($commande->id, $tab_paiement['technical_code'], false, $amount_to_pay, false) . '</td>
    </tr>';
    }
    }
    }
    [/CODE]


    => Il faut modifier la constante de langue SEND_CHECK (ligne 210) dans le fichier de langue lib/lang/fr.php.



    => Il faut modifier la constante de langue SEND_TRANSFER (ligne 209) dans le fichier de langue lib/lang/fr.php.

    Ces corrections seront dans la futur version de PEEL.
    • 0
  3. Simon développeur PEEL a ajouté un message dans un sujet  Problème mise ? niveau de la Base peel 6.4.2   

    Bonjour,

    Le champ annonce_number a été ajouté dans la table peel_banniere pour la 6.4.1. J'ai mis à jour la note dans laquelle l'ajout du champ manquait.
    • 0
  4. Simon développeur PEEL a ajouté un message dans un sujet  Sortie de la nouvelle version PEEL Shopping 6.4   

    A partir de maintenant, lorsque vous téléchargez PEEL SHOPPING 6.4 vous avez droit à la version 6.4.1 :
    Fonctionnalités / améliorations :
    - Ajout de graphe pour utilisateur dans l'administration
    - Ajout de la gestion de dates courtes sans l'année
    - Ajout de la zone tva pour la fonction order
    - Amélioration de la gestion de l'affichage des dates pour les graphes
    - Amélioration de la gestion des images dans les pages d'annonces
    - Adaptation du code pour une gestion du multilingue simplifiée
    - Administration multilingue des partenaires dans l'administration
    - Amélioration de l'interface d'ajout de commentaires
    - Standardisation des formattages de dates
    - Prise en compte de la notion de commission sur taux de change
    - Mise en place de la gestion de prix revendeur dans l'administration des attributs
    - Mise en place lien nouveautés dans le menu
    - Gestion du multilingue dans le formulaire de recherche
    - Amélioration de la gestion des bannières
    - Amélioration gestion des vitrines
    - Amélioration présentation boutique
    - Amélioration URL Rewriting
    - amélioration de la compatibité avec les anciennes versions
    - Amélioration présentation
    - Amélioration du module Paypal (ipn)
    - Amélioration de la gestion multilingue
    - Amélioration de la génération des lignes dans l'export des produits
    - Amélioration de la gestion de l'état des modules
    - Prise en compte de la possibilité de se logguer via une application tierce automatiquement
    - Ajout du nombre d'avis par produit
    - Ajout du nom du produit dans le fil d'ariane.
    - Ajout des informations utilisateurs dans page de profil
    - Ajout d'un chapô automatique pour les articles dans la rubrique et qui ont des sous-rubriques
    - Ajout de gestion de guide_simplified dans les modules

    Optimisation du code (rapidité, compatibilité, sécurité, homogénéité, etc.) :
    - Optimisation des requêtes
    - Amélioration de la génération des balises metas
    - Optimisation du chargement des javascripts
    - Optimisation vitesse du site
    - Adaptation du code pour simplification
    - Mise en place de cache sur les pages de catégories

    Correction de bogues :
    - Correction bug d'envoi d'emails
    - Correction bug liste cadeau
    - Correction bug prix / quantité
    - Correction bug sur lien vers vitrines
    - Correction de l'affichage pour les dates de naissance et commentaires
    - Correction du message de désactivation de l'envoi d'email.
    - Correction et amélioration de la gestion par les utilisateurs des vitrines
    - Correction lisibilité vote
    - Correction présentation page partenaires
    - correction priorité décodage URL
    - Correction scope des sessions
    - Gestion des changements de langue sur pages de boutiques verified
    - Restructuration page édition d'utilisateur
    - Modification de la gestion des langues
    - Correction validité XHTML
    - Correction mise en page
    - Correction insertion des droits
    - Correction du menu : présélection du bon menu
    - Correction bug sur compte statut
    - Correction des bannières sur le moteur de recherche
    - Correction de la couleur des liens
    - Correction de l'usage de wwwroot_admin
    - Correction de l'application de la contrainte d'affichage en alternance pair/impair pour les bannières
    - Correction de l'enregistrement du type de livraison lors de la modification d'une commande en back office.
    - Correction de l'envoi d'email lors de l'installation
    - Correction de l'affichage du nombre de produit
    - Correction de bug si site non marchand
    - Correction code pays
    - Correction affichage des notes dans l'administration
    - correction affichage lien footer
    - Correction affichage liste de liens
    - Correction affichage présentation boutique dans profil
    - Correction des différents niveaux d'administrateurs

    Pour migrer d'une version 6.4.0, si vous n'avez pas touché au code PHP :
    - faites un backup complet du code de votre boutique
    - téléchargez le zip
    - dézippez le fichier et supprimez "/lib/setup/info.inc.php", "/installation/" et si vous n'avez pas un modèle totalement standard : supprimez aussi "/modeles/peel6/"
    - mettez tous ces fichiers à la place de ceux de votre boutique

    - exécutez le SQL suivant :

    ALTER TABLE `peel_profil` CHANGE `priv` `priv` varchar(255) NOT NULL DEFAULT '';
    ALTER TABLE `peel_sites` CHANGE `facebook_page_link` `facebook_page_link` varchar(255) NOT NULL DEFAULT '';
    ALTER TABLE `peel_banniere` CHANGE `etat` `etat` tinyint(4) NOT NULL DEFAULT '0',
    ALTER TABLE `peel_banniere` DROP `appearance`

    ALTER TABLE `peel_banniere` ADD `search_words_list` TEXT NOT NULL ,
    ADD `alt` VARCHAR( 255 ) NOT NULL DEFAULT '',
    ADD `on_home_page` TINYINT( 1 ) NOT NULL DEFAULT '0',
    ADD `on_search_engine_page` TINYINT( 1 ) NOT NULL DEFAULT '0',
    ADD `on_other_page` TINYINT( 1 ) NOT NULL DEFAULT '0',
    ADD `annonce_number` int(11) NOT NULL DEFAULT '0',
    ADD `keywords` MEDIUMTEXT NOT NULL DEFAULT '',
    ADD `list_id` VARCHAR( 255 ) NOT NULL DEFAULT '',
    ADD `pages_allowed` ENUM( 'all', 'odd', 'even' ) NOT NULL DEFAULT 'all' ;
    • 0
  5. Simon développeur PEEL a ajouté un message dans un sujet  Fichier inexistant   

    Bonjour,

    Si le chemin /lib/FCKeditor/editor/css/fck_ediorarea.css existe bien sur le serveur, est que lorsque tu appels la page http://www.le_nom_de_domaine.tld/lib/FCKeditor/editor/css/fck_ediorarea.css le serveur envoie bien la page, le problème se situe dans ce qui n'est pas retourné par REQUEST_URI. Si tu utilises la fonction peel get_current_url(), l'email sera plus complet et permettra peut-être de trouver l'origine du problème
    • 0
  6. Simon développeur PEEL a ajouté un message dans un sujet  Modification du design de peel   

    Bonjour,

    La fonction affiche_contenu_html retourne la valeur du champ contenu_html de la table peel_html par le biais de la requête


    $sql = 'SELECT *
    FROM peel_html
    WHERE emplacement="' . nohtml_real_escape_string($place) . '" AND etat="1" AND lang="' . $_SESSION['session_langue'] . '"
    ORDER BY a_timestamp DESC';
    [/CODE]

    => Le contenu de cette table est administrable en back office
    • 0
  7. Simon développeur PEEL a ajouté un message dans un sujet  Fichier inexistant   

    Bonjour,

    J'ai deux questions :
    Avez-vous le lien entier de la page appeler dans votre email ?
    Quelle page utilisez-vous pour l'envoi d'email ?
    • 0
  8. Simon développeur PEEL a ajouté un message dans un sujet  Modification du design de peel   

    Bonjour,

    L'affichage sur PEEL est composé de différents éléments :
    - Le dossier templates modeles/peel6.
    - Les fichiers lib/fonctions/display_XXXX.php contiennent les fonctions d'affichages.

    Le dossier modeles contient le css du site, les images ainsi que le fichier haut.php qui est appelé à chaque page et qui affiche la partie supérieur et la colonne de gauche du site. Le fichier bas.php affiche la colonne de droite et le footer.
    Les fonctions des fichiers display_XXXX.php (et de nouvelles fonctions d'affichage) peuvent être défini dans le fichier modeles/display_custom.php.
    • 0
  9. Simon développeur PEEL a ajouté un message dans un sujet  Pop up interstitiel   

    Bonjour,

    La correction proposé par paulanna est la bonne. Avez-vous vidé le cache de votre navigateur (qui doit contenir l'ancienne version de interstitiel.js ) avant votre essai?
    • 0
  10. Simon développeur PEEL a ajouté un message dans un sujet  Franco   

    Bonjour,

    Pouvoir appliquer un seuil de franco de port différent selon les catégories est un développement conséquent, qui nécessite de nombreuses interventions dans le code.
    Nous pouvons réaliser ce développement si vous le souhaitez, il faut dans ce cas prendre contact avec un conseiller commercial au 01 75 43 67 97 qui vous accompagnera tout au long du projet.
    • 0
  11. Simon développeur PEEL a ajouté un message dans un sujet  Ajout d'une langue   

    Bonjour,

    Il n'est pas nécessaire de fermer ce sujet qui concerne l'ajout d'une langue sur PEEL de manière général.
    • 0
  12. Simon développeur PEEL a ajouté un message dans un sujet  Changement de TVA   

    Bonjour,

    Dans l'onglet Gestion du site, le menu Tarifs de livraison vous permet de sélectionner une TVA pour chacun de moyen de transport. Avez-vous modifié cette page?
    • 0
  13. Simon développeur PEEL a ajouté un message dans un sujet  Avis expédition peel premium 5.71   

    Bonjour,

    Pour être en copie des emails d'expédition envoyé par la boutique, il faut ajouter un envoi vers l'administrateur de l'email qui est envoyé au client; Dans la fonction send_avis_expedition, il faut dupliquer la ligne

    mail($com->email, "[$site] " . ORDER_SHIPPING_WARNING . " $commandeid", $message, "From: $support_commande");
    en modifiant $com->email par $support_commande
    • 0
  14. Simon développeur PEEL a ajouté un message dans un sujet  Pas de confirmation de commande au client ainsi qu'? l'administration   

    Bonjour vnintoz,

    Recevez-vous d’autres emails de la boutique ? Si vous ne recevez pas d'autres emails, le problème se situe peut-être au niveau de votre hébergeur.
    Selon votre version, le paramètre Activation de l'envoi d'emails sur tout le site : dans le bloc Gestion des emails doit être activé.
    • 0
  15. Simon développeur PEEL a ajouté un message dans un sujet  le rewriting ne marche pas   

    Bonjour,

    Je ne parviens toujours pas à reproduire le problème ....
    J'ai testé avec Internet Explorer 8 et 9, et firefox 13, chrome 21. Quel navigateur utilisez-vous ?
    • 0
  16. Simon développeur PEEL a ajouté un message dans un sujet  affichage pdf   

    Bonjour,

    Si la version de PHP est inférieur à 5, vous pouvez décommenter les lignes
    # SetEnv PHP_VER 5
    # SetEnv REGISTER_GLOBALS 0
    dans le fichier.htacess à la racine de votre site
    • 0
  17. Simon développeur PEEL a ajouté un message dans un sujet  Administration en anglais   

    Bonjour,

    L'administration n'est pas internationalisé, seul les valeurs venant de la BDD sont multilingues.
    • 0
  18. Simon développeur PEEL a ajouté un message dans un sujet  Ajout d'une langue   

    Bonjour,

    Une raison pour laquelle se problème se produit est qu'il n'y a aucun type d'expédition défini pour la zone et pour le montant total du panier (ou le poids total des articles). Cette configuration se fait dans la page 'tarifs de livraison' de l'onglet 'paramètre du site' en back office.
    • 0
  19. Simon développeur PEEL a ajouté un message dans un sujet  problème gestion meta pour référencement   

    Bonjour,

    Lorsque aucune balise meta n'est renseigné, le code prend alors les keywords générique défini dans l'onglet webmastering > "Gestion des métas" en back office.
    Ce code concatène ensuite la description du site :


    $this_keywords .= $this_description . ',' .$m_default['meta_key_' . $_SESSION['session_langue']];
    [/CODE] Quelques traitements sont fait sur la chaine de caractère qui résulte de l'opération ci dessus (suppression des mots de moins de 4 lettres, limitation à 30 mots (le commentaire est erroné, ce sera corrigé pour la futur version) du nombre de mots clé dans la balise, remplacement de caractère par des virgules) : [CODE]
    if (!empty($this_keywords)) {
    // Nettoyage des mots cl&#233;s - on n'en garde que 20 maximum
    $temp_array = array_unique(explode(',',trim(strip_tags(str_replace(array("\r", "\n", "\t", '!', '?', '(', ')', '.', '#', ';', ' ', '+', '-', " ", ".", '"', "'"), ',', String::html_entity_decode(str_replace(array(' '), ',', String::strtolower($this_keywords))))))));
    foreach($temp_array as $this_key => $this_value) {
    if (String::strlen($this_value) < 4) {
    unset($temp_array[$this_key]);
    }
    }
    $this_keywords=implode(', ',array_slice($temp_array, 0, 30));
    }
    => Ce qui vous gène est l'ajout de la description du site dans les mots clés. Je vous propose de simplement supprimer $this_description . ',' de la ligne 151 du fichier lib/fonctions/display.php, ce qui donne
    $this_keywords .= $m_default['meta_key_' . $_SESSION['session_langue']];
    [/code] Si vous souhaitez modifier le nombre de mots clés dans la balise, il faut changer le [b]30[/b] par le nombre que vous souhaitez dans la ligne [CODE]$this_keywords=implode(', ',array_slice($temp_array, 0, 30));
    • 0
  20. Simon développeur PEEL a ajouté un message dans un sujet  le rewriting ne marche pas   

    Bonjour,

    Je ne parviens toujours pas à reproduire le problème. Pouvez-vous fournir le code source HTML de la page correspondante au screenshot svp ?

    Sur votre installation en local, avez-vous la ligne

    ErrorDocument 404 /search.php?type=error404
    ?
    • 0
  21. Simon développeur PEEL a ajouté un message dans un sujet  problème gestion meta pour référencement   

    Bonjour


    Oui, le remplissage automatique de la balise keywords est fait uniquement si le champ meta_key est vide. Dans la fonction affiche meta de lib/fonctions/display.php, le code qui gère le remplissage est


    if(String::strlen($this_keywords)<60){
    if (!empty($m['meta_key'])) {
    $this_keywords .= $m['meta_key'];
    } elseif (!empty($GLOBALS['strSpecificMeta']['Keywords'][$page_name])) {
    $this_keywords .= $GLOBALS['strSpecificMeta']['Keywords'][$page_name];
    } else {
    // On va prendre la description en plus des mots cl&#233;s par d&#233;faut, et on retraitera ensuite
    $this_keywords .= $this_description . ',' .$m_default['meta_key_' . $_SESSION['session_langue']];
    }
    }
    [/CODE]
    => Pouvez-vous vérifier que le test
    if (!empty($m['meta_key'])) {
    $this_keywords .= $m['meta_key'];
    }
    est présent sur votre copie ?

    Merci.
    • 0
  22. Simon développeur PEEL a ajouté un message dans un sujet  le rewriting ne marche pas   

    Bonjour,

    Pouvez-vous fournir un screenshot de ce que vous voyez svp ?
    Lorsque je modifie achat/ ou cat- dans l'url comme dans vos exemple, je suis naturellement dirigé vers la page d'erreur 404.
    • 0
  23. Simon développeur PEEL a ajouté un message dans un sujet  module wanewsletter sur peel 6.4.1   

    Bonjour,

    Avez-vous ajouté un fichier .htacess dans le répertoire modules/newsletter ou modules/newsletter/peel ?
    Sinon, pouvez vous m'envoyer par MP les accès au site svp ?

    Merci
    • 0
  24. Simon développeur PEEL a ajouté un message dans un sujet  probleme installation peel shopping 6.4   

    Bonjour,

    Assurez vous que la version de PHP utilisé par votre hébergement est supérieur ou égal à 5.3.
    Dans le fichier .htaccess à la racine de votre boutique, vous trouverez des paramétrages à décommenter en fonction de votre hébergeur qui permettent de modifier la version de PHP utilisé par votre hébergement.
    Si votre hébergeur ne se trouve pas dans cette liste, vous pouvez prendre contact avec lui afin de connaitre la marche à suivre.
    • 0
  25. Simon développeur PEEL a ajouté un message dans un sujet  Pas de confirmation de commande au client ainsi qu'? l'administration   

    Bonjour,

    Pouvez-vous vérifier que le templates d'email 'email_commande' soient activé dans le back office. Ensuite, y a t'il le problème avec tous les moyens de paiements ?
    • 0

Twitter Advisto ecommerce

Facebook PEEL Shopping